She is the bridge between bloom and ruin.
Dr. Persephone Kore is brilliant, stubborn, and utterly devoted to her work. As her mother Demeter’s caged prodigy, she has to be. Her bioengineering research could feed nations or be weaponized by them. Tension flares to war, shattering everything she knows. Persephone is kidnapped by her own guards and thrust into a hidden facility where secrets lurk under the strict rules, power is fragile, and every choice carries the weight of life and death.
The vast Underground is built to endure an apocalypse, but it comes at a cost: strict rules over every aspect of life, inflexible classes, and bargains she can’t begin to understand. Persephone’s arrival disrupts the order, stirring rivalries, igniting passions, and altering the delicate balance of power and control.
The betrayal from her guards blooms into more as her crush turns out to be more than he seems. Here, at the end of the world, balancing between duty and desire, Persephone must determine how to create her own life, her own freedom, and her happiness. Is she a pawn in someone else’s game, or a queen in her own right?
The Ballad of Ashes and Spring is a sweeping tale of resilience, betrayal, intrigue, and forbidden attraction. It reimagines the myth of Hades and Persephone, asking the reader if Hades stole Demeter’s bright flower or if she descended to seek solitude and her lover’s touch. It is hope against the ruins of war and a single spark of defiance can alter the fate of an entire world.

KR Paul’s Pantheon 3: Return of Apollo continues the advanced military tactics on high-stakes missions around the globe with the now exposed group of American military teleportation operators known to the world as the Pantheon. After being exposed during the Battle of DC, the team of individuals with extraordinary abilities is now navigating a world of espionage, power struggles, and personal losses while their faces are known by every American. The third book in the series follows Valerie “Athena” Hall, the leader of the Pantheon, as she grapples with her new leadership challenges, managing two now public facing companies, shifting alliances, and the ever-present threat of the Russian extremist group, Svoboda.
Apollo, the former ally of Miller Thompson, walks straight through the front doors of the Limitless Logistics headquarters, sewing chaos and confusion from the very first chapter. After proving he is on their side, or at least, not against them he is able to provide valuable intelligence about Svoboda’s next move. Val and her team must decide whether to trust him, accepting the risk he presents, while facing increasing instability within Russia and its oligarchy, where power vacuums threaten global security.
Like Pantheon and Pantheon 2: Ares & Athena, Pantheon 3: Return of Apollo continues KR Paul’s fine balance of heart pounding action and deeply developed characters who’s personal lives and choices expose an arc of loss, betrayal, and redemption. This plays against the lingering internal tensions within the Pantheon, now split into two companies, threaten their unity, especially as personal relationships intertwine with their missions.
With its blend of military strategy, political intrigue, deep character exploration, magic, and mayhem, Return of Apollo delivers a gripping and emotionally charged continuation of the Pantheon series as it battles for the very soul of the Pantheon.

A casual date turns into a horrific attack that leads US Air Force Captain Valerie Hall to discover she has the power of teleportation. Her military career takes a sudden kinetic turn—she isn’t the only one with Jump skills. Val is drawn into a world where teleportation meets advanced military tactics on high-stakes missions around the globe with the ultra-secret group of American military teleportation operators known to few as the Pantheon.
She learns to adapt her new-found skill to transition from administrative to a full-dress special operator—and the Pantheon must form an uneasy alliance with a band of Russian teleportation experts in order to take down a larger enemy that threatens both nations.

Staff Sergeant Murphy Hawkins, USMC, discovers he can teleport himself and others when a routine patrol goes sideways. He saves his team, but his special skills force him into the world of unconventional logistics and Special Operations. Murphy joins the Limitless Logistics team, known to some as the “Pantheon.” Their mission is a strange blend of logistics and combat, but far less combat than he would like.
Valerie Hall, recently promoted to the second in command of Limitless Logistics, now has a hot headed, ultra-macho, CrossFit loving Marine to train and they do not get along. She has to ensure he receives the training he needs to survive working with their Spec Ops mission partners while overcoming the administrative and bureaucratic nightmare of running a covert logistics team.
What looks like a terror attack on US soil detonates into chaos across the US—and the entire Pantheon must halt a second attack.
